Transaction 2a3bc80accc2f8bf351422624ae839e044ab6da08b72e9851d1ae0a244e0350f
1 Input
2 Outputs
- 2a3bc80accc2f8bf351422624ae839e044ab6da08b72e9851d1ae0a244e0350f:0
- 2a3bc80accc2f8bf351422624ae839e044ab6da08b72e9851d1ae0a244e0350f:1
value 14787431
address 16cWtgd7kSEdnJxyJuMfbfErgpyjmQdMjV
value 1024687128
address 1Fe2cvAudzo4ts1JifgYJGgUhgKVo6xn4K